Comprehending Built-In Appliances
Built-in appliances are gadgets created to be integrated into kitchen or home structures perfectly. Unlike freestanding appliances, which built in oven to buy can be moved and repositioned, built-in designs are normally set up into cabinetry or specific built-in areas during brand-new home building or considerable restorations. This enables a cohesive style, optimizing performance while improving visual appeal.

Space Efficiency
Built-in appliances are developed to use area better. They can be tailored to fit comfortably within existing cabinets or unique architectural features of a home.
2. Visual Appeal
The integration of appliances enables homeowners to create a clean and cohesive look. The lack of large makers promotes a tidy environment, making spaces, especially cooking areas, look more large and arranged.
3. Boosted Functionality
Many built-in appliances included sophisticated features, allowing users to optimize their cooking efforts. The smooth style also motivates effective workflow in the kitchen, an important aspect for cooking lovers.
4. Increased Property Value
Top quality built-in appliances often include considerable worth to homes, as they show contemporary design and practical performance. Potential buyers are typically drawn in to homes equipped with these updated functions.
5. Customization Options
Property owners can select from a range of surfaces, styles, and innovations, enabling them to tailor their space. Whether choosing for stainless steel, panel-ready choices, or unique colors, there is an almost limitless series of options.

Are built-in appliances more expensive than freestanding ones?
Built-in appliances tend to be more expensive due to their custom-made nature and installation procedures. Nevertheless, the added worth and advantages can justify the investment, especially in premium designs and innovations.
2. Can built-in appliances be moved quickly?
No, built-in appliances are normally not created to be moved. They are set up into cabinets, making moving difficult and frequently needing significant effort and remodeling.
3. How do I keep built-in appliances?
Upkeep depends on the type of home appliance. Regular cleansing is advised in addition to periodic look for any service concerns. Always refer to the producer's standards for specific maintenance needs.
4. Are built-in appliances energy-efficient?
Lots of built-in appliances are created to be more energy-efficient than older or freestanding designs, often geared up with features that minimize energy consumption.
5. Can I install built-in appliances myself?
While some homeowners might pick to set up appliances themselves, it's often recommended to work with an expert, specifically for electrical or pipes connections. Appropriate setup guarantees safety and optimal efficiency.
